I. Foundation Requirements- Minimum City Foundation Standards
NAalf
A.
Concrete minimum compression strength of 3000 PSI
B.
Minimum four 4 inch slab thickness
C.
Vapor barrier Emil. Poly min.
D.
Slab/beam or pier layout shown
1. Footings/beams are continuous over the length and width of foundation
2. Footings 30" exterior, 24" interior, unless over 60' long must be 30"
3. Spacing of beams does not exceed 15'
E.
Reinforcement details to meet minimum requirements
1. Slab reinforcement
2. Exterior beam reinforcement
3. Interior beam reinforcement
4. Masonry fireplace foundation reinforcement
F.
Wood foundation details indicated

III. Stairway Requirements
OK
K
A. Stairway Details
OK
1. Maximum riser height 7-3/4 inches
2. Minimum tread width 10 inches
3. Stairway risers are uniform 3/8" Max. difference
4. Stairway width not less than 36 inches
5. Stairway headroom not less that six ft. eight 6-8
B. Winder details
1. Treads a minimum of six 6 inches on narrow edge
2. Treads a minimum often (10) inches at a distance of twelve (12) inches from the
narrow edge
C. Spiral stairway details
1. Riser height less than nine and one-half 9-1/2 inches
2. Treads a minimum of seven and one-half (7-1/2) inches at a distance of twelve (12)
inches from the narrow edge
3. Stairway width not less than thirty-six inches
4. Headroom required not less than six ft six 6-6 inches
5. All treads must be identical
D. Guards/handrail details
1. Guards required when a porch, deck, balcony or landing is thirty (30) inches
above grade or finished floor
2. Handrails are required on stairways located two or more risers above floor/grade
3. Handrails must be thirty-four to thirty-eight (34-38) inches when measured from the
leading edge of the tread
4. Handrails must not project more than four & one-half (4-1/2) inches into width of a
stairway
5. Guards must be a minimum of thirty-six 36 inches above finished floor
6. Guards & handrails along open-side(s) of stairway must have intermediate
railing or uprights that prevent the passage of a four 4 inch sphere
IV. Fireplace Requirements
N
A. Hearth extensions
1. Fireplace opening < 6 s , ft, extensions: 8" & 16" forward
2. Fireplace opening > 6 s . ft. extensions: 12" side & 20" forward
B. Masonry fireplace requires 2" clearance from all combustible materials
C. Chimneys must meet IRC Chapter 10 Requirements

VI. Plumbing Requirements
A. Pressure reducing valve required when water pressure exceeds 80 psi
NOV
B. Plumbing access to bathtubs
C. Means for thermal expansion provided when required
D. Water heaters elevated 18" when installed in the garage or room directly off garage
VII. Mechanical Requirements
N
A. All mechanical ventilation's in bathrooms & range hood ventilation must be ducted to
outside excludes ductless units
B. Attic installed H.V.A.C. requirements:
1. Twenty-four (24) inch wide unobstructed walkway from attic access to equipment
must be provided
2. Attic access located within 20 feet of equipment
C. Combustion air supplied for gas appliances when required)
